网站首页 站内搜索

搜索结果

查询Tags标签: keys,共有 223条记录
  • Selenium2+python自动化12-操作元素(键盘和鼠标事件)

    前言 在前面的几篇中重点介绍了一些元素的到位方法,到位到元素后,接下来就是需要操作元素了。本篇总结了web页面常用的一些操作元素方法,可以统称为行为事件 有些web界面的选项菜单需要鼠标悬停在某个元素上才能显示出来(如百度页面的设置按钮)。 一、简单操作1.点击…

    2021/6/3 12:25:57 人评论 次浏览
  • Selenium2+python自动化23-富文本(自动发帖)

    前言富文本编辑框是做web自动化最常见的场景,有很多小伙伴遇到了不知道无从下手,本篇以博客园的编辑器为例,解决如何定位富文本,输入文本内容 一、加载配置1.打开博客园写随笔,首先需要登录,这里为了避免透露个人账户信息,我直接加载配置文件,免登录了。不懂如何加…

    2021/6/3 12:25:23 人评论 次浏览
  • Selenium2+python自动化33-文件上传(send_keys)

    前言 文件上传是web页面上很常见的一个功能,自动化成功中操作起来却不是那么简单。 一般分两个场景:一种是input标签,这种可以用selenium提供的send_keys()方法轻松解决; 另外一种非input标签实现起来比较困难,可以借助autoit工具或者SendKeys第三方库。 本篇以博客园…

    2021/6/3 12:23:59 人评论 次浏览
  • 前端数据处理

    目标:处理从api获取到的数据,使之格式统一。问题起因:对于需要的数组、对象数据因前后端执行任务前没有对关键字段进行商讨统一,造成前后端使用的关键字段不同,需要重构项目 解决: 简单数据处理对于数组数据可直接赋值;//伪代码let res = getData()//获取api数据le…

    2021/6/2 18:51:05 人评论 次浏览
  • 前端进阶算法3:从浏览器缓存淘汰策略和Vue的keep-alive学习LRU算法

    > 引言 这个标题已经很明显的告诉我们:前端需要了解 LRU 算法! 这也是前端技能的亮点,当面试官在问到你前端开发中遇到过哪些算法,你也可以把这部分丢过去! 本节按以下步骤切入:由浏览器缓存策略引出 LRU 算法原理 然后走进 vue 中 keep-alive 的应用 接着,透过…

    2021/5/17 20:25:41 人评论 次浏览
  • selenium3 qq邮箱上传下载

    实现功能:qq邮箱上传附件定位元素:此为input标签,可以直接用send_keys方法,进入到邮箱页面后,首先click写信,driver需切换到frame通过name定位:UploadFile代码如下:# _*_ coding:utf-8 _*_from selenium import webdriverfrom selenium.webdriver.common.action_chai…

    2021/5/15 18:30:12 人评论 次浏览
  • Redission分布式锁原理

    Redission 1、原理 2、源码中加锁lua代码if (redis.call(exists, KEYS[1]) == 0) then redis.call(hset, KEYS[1], ARGV[2], 1);redis.call(pexpire, KEYS[1], ARGV[1]); return nil;end; if (redis.call(hexists, KEYS[1], ARGV[2]) == 1) thenredis.call(hincrby, KEYS…

    2021/5/14 19:55:41 人评论 次浏览
  • 2021面试-Redis

    RedisRedis 是一个开源(BSD许可)的,内存中的数据结构存储系统,它可以用作数据库、缓存和消息中间件。 它支持多种类型的数据结构,如 字符串(strings), 散列(hashes), 列表(lists), 集合(sets), 有序集合(sorted sets) 与范围查询, bitmaps, hyperlog…

    2021/5/13 19:31:32 人评论 次浏览
  • CentOS 7 如何实现SSH自动登录

    我们经常会需要从本地linux主机登录到服务端Linux主机,每次登录都需要输入密码,以下步骤可以实现免密码自动登录。 1. 本地LINUX主机生成RSA密钥对 ssh-keygen -t rsa出现提示默认都回车,输出结果类似此时会在.ssh目录生成两个文件 id_rsa id_rsa.pub2. 将公钥文件远程…

    2021/5/8 7:31:04 人评论 次浏览
  • python_selenium_StaleElementReferenceException

    try:self.driver.find_element(*LogInLocators.submit_btn).send_keys(Keys.ENTER)except StaleElementReferenceException as msg:print("unable to locate element submit_btn%s", msg)print("relocate element submit_btn")self.driver.find_eleme…

    2021/5/7 22:27:10 人评论 次浏览
  • redis 用scan 代替keys 解决百万数据模糊查询超时问题

    转: redis 用scan 代替keys 解决百万数据模糊查询超时问题 redis 用scan 代替keys 解决百万数据模糊查询超时问题参考文章: (1)redis 用scan 代替keys 解决百万数据模糊查询超时问题 (2)https://www.cnblogs.com/zjk1/p/9619782.html 备忘一下。 转: redis 用scan …

    2021/5/5 19:30:50 人评论 次浏览
  • Redis基础-Key通用指令

    Key的作用 通过Key查询Redis中数据 基本操作 type:获取key的类型 del:删除key exists:key是否存在拓展操作 设置key的有效期 expire:(单位:秒) pexpire:(单位:毫秒) expireat:(时间戳——秒) pexpireat:(时间戳——毫秒)ttl:获取key的有效时间 pttl:当…

    2021/5/5 19:25:17 人评论 次浏览
  • redis分布式锁 vs 双写一致性

    Redis简单概述:今天主要简单聊聊Redis在工作中的一些应用,有说的不对的地方勿拍砖啊。说到Redis,可能有不少朋友会说它就是一个缓存数据库,没错它确实主要是干缓存这件事,在我之前仅用过它的String或者再多一点Hash这两结构的时候,我也一度觉这么认为。再后来因为工…

    2021/5/4 19:28:20 人评论 次浏览
  • mac vscode使用密钥连接linux

    1.创建公钥 1.在本地Mac终端下创建公钥 ssh-keygen 备注:在这个过程中会有创建文件保存的公钥的提示(Enter file in which to save the key (/home/andron/.ssh/id_rsa): )直接回车即可(若已经创建公钥则会提示是否覆盖,yes),接下来提示输入密码和再次输入密码,继…

    2021/5/1 7:25:55 人评论 次浏览
  • vue源码学习(第一张) this访问data数据 拆散之后并不难

    vue源码学习(第一张)this访问data数据 前言 本文章,为了让大家理解为什么我们实例化Vue对象中我们可以用this来访问data中的数据。这里我们大部分都是用的源码,简化的部分很少,但是还是有所修剪。 我们使用的函数 VueVue对象initData初始化我们的data数据getData如果…

    2021/4/29 1:25:20 人评论 次浏览
扫一扫关注最新编程教程